On Friday, April 24th, our Chapter orchestrated a new program called PR For A Day connecting volunteer members with nonprofits throughout the region.

More than 15 chapter members partnered with nonprofit agencies in their communities for a day to donate their experience and skills in public relations and marketing efforts.

The PR For A Day program is a first for the chapter, said Liz Smith, president of the chapter and chair of the PRSA Mid-Atlantic District. Managed by the chapter’s public service committee co-chairs Valeria Beussink and Liz Greenaway, professionals as well as students volunteered at least three hours of their time with their paired organizations, helping a multitude of nonprofits.

“Many nonprofit organizations in our area do not have the funds for professional public relations assistance on a full-time basis,” said Smith, principal of Integrated Communications Ventures based in York, Pa. “PRSA PR For A Day helped more than a dozen different nonprofits in our area with their public relations needs.”

Donated work included revising website content, providing social media assistance, copywriting and designing marketing pieces and helping to produce videos. Nonprofits included in the program range from healthcare to international community organizations.

“Successful nonprofits strengthen our communities and lead to a better quality of life for all of us in Central PA,” Smith said. “We anticipate this program will become an annual event for our chapter.”
